Produktbeschreibung
Medicinal Plants: How to Grow and Use Them in Daily Life is a comprehensive and heart-centered guide for anyone seeking to reconnect with nature, cultivate healing at home, and embrace a more conscious lifestyle. Written with clarity, warmth, and deep respect for ancestral wisdom, this book invites readers into the world of herbal medicine through the practical lens of home gardening.

Whether you live in a small apartment or have a spacious backyard, this guide shows you how to transform any corner into a thriving medicinal garden. With step-by-step instructions, seasonal tips, and creative solutions for limited spaces, you'll learn how to grow herbs like mint, chamomile, aloe vera, lavender, lemon balm, and rosemaryplants known for their powerful healing properties and ease of cultivation.

Across 36 richly detailed chapters, author Sandro Chequetto walks you through every stage of the journey: from preparing soil and choosing containers to harvesting, drying, and transforming herbs into teas, oils, ointments, compresses, and culinary delights. You'll discover how to care for your plants daily, protect them from pests using natural methods, and create remedies that support digestion, immunity, sleep, emotional balance, skin health, and more.

But this book goes beyond technique. It explores the emotional and spiritual dimensions of gardening, revealing how tending to plants can become a therapeutic practice. You'll learn how to involve children and elders in the process, how to build a natural first aid kit, and how to use gardening as a tool for education, community empowerment, and sustainability. With chapters on Brazilian medicinal plants, lunar gardening, biodynamic principles, and wild plant identification, the book honors both traditional knowledge and modern ecological awareness.

Each page is infused with the belief that to cultivate is to careand that caring for plants is a way of caring for yourself, your family, and the planet. Whether you're a beginner or a seasoned gardener, this guide offers inspiration, practical wisdom, and a gentle reminder that healing is always within reachrooted in the soil, blooming in your hands.

Inside this book, you'll find:

  • A complete beginner's guide to growing medicinal herbs at home
  • Techniques for planting, pruning, harvesting, and preserving
  • Recipes for teas, infusions, oils, ointments, and herbal meals
  • Tips for gardening in small spaces, urban areas, and schools
  • Insights into emotional healing, spiritual connection, and sustainable living
  • A monthly gardening calendar and journal prompts
  • Profiles of 30+ medicinal plants and their uses
  • A final message of gratitude and encouragement to keep growing


Whether you're seeking natural remedies, a deeper connection to the Earth, or a peaceful daily ritual, Medicinal Plants: How to Grow and Use Them in Daily Life is your companion on the path to wellness, wisdom, and renewal.
